WebThe variable star Mira at two different times. A variable star is a star whose brightness as seen from Earth (its apparent magnitude) changes with time. This variation may be caused by a change in emitted light or by something partly blocking the light, so variable stars are classified as either: Intrinsic variables, whose luminosity actually ... It cancels the effects of image artifacts caused by variations in the pixel-to-pixel sensitivity of the detector and by ... cocktail encyclopediaWebApr 21, 2007 · Each sky type also has some unique and subtle brightness variations. The brightness gradient of an overcast sky is radially symmetric, while the brightness distribution of the other two sky types distribution is asymmetric. For a clear sky the darkest part of the sky dome is the area 90 degrees opposite the sun. cocktail e long drinkWebOct 11, 2024 · The brightness of a star is measured several ways: how it appears from Earth, how bright it would appear from a standard distance and how much energy it emits. ...
